Earlier Report Observations

The market volume for prepared or preserved groundnuts in Bosnia and Herzegovina contracted from 1 582 t in 2018 to 1 432 t in 2024, reflecting an overall decline over the period. This decrease was marked by a sharp drop in 2019 and 2020, followed by stabilization and a modest recovery in the later years. In value terms, the market fell from $5.1 million to $4.85 million, with notable fluctuations including a significant contraction in 2019 and a rebound in 2021.

Domestic production showed volatility, peaking at 664 t in 2023 before falling back to 599 t in 2024. The interplay between production, imports, and exports influenced the total market size, with import volumes declining from 1 199 t in 2018 to 1 057 t in 2024, while exports also varied. The market's value dynamics were affected by changing unit prices, as seen in the divergent trends between volume and value, particularly in 2020 when value rose despite a volume drop.

By 2024, the market demonstrated a slight upward trend in both volume and value compared to the lows of 2020-2022, indicating a period of gradual recovery. However, the overall market size remained below the 2018 level, suggesting that the sector has not fully regained its earlier scale.

Production prepared or preserved groundnuts in Bosnia and Herzegovina

In value, 2018-2021, K $ US

Following two consecutive years of decline, Bosnia and Herzegovina's production of prepared or preserved groundnuts showed an increase. In 2021, the output was valued at 1 858 thousand US dollars, marking a modest rise of 1.4% compared to the previous year. Over the period from 2018 to 2021, production decreased by 16.3%, which translates to an annualized decline of 5.8%. The lowest value was recorded in 2020 at 1 832 thousand US dollars, while the largest decline occurred in 2019, with a drop of 16.2%.

Production of prepared or preserved groundnuts in Bosnia and Herzegovina fell for the second year in a row. In 2021, the country produced 497.6 tonnes, representing a year-on-year decrease of 12.6%. Between 2018 and 2021, production declined by 16.9%, equivalent to an annualized rate of 6.0%. The highest output was recorded in 2019 at 620.4 tonnes, which also saw the largest increase of 3.6%.

Exports prepared or preserved groundnuts from Bosnia and Herzegovina

Exports in kind, t

Export volumes of prepared or preserved groundnuts from Bosnia and Herzegovina dropped for the second consecutive year. In 2021, the country exported 212 tonnes, indicating a measured decline of 8.3% compared to the previous year. The peak export volume was recorded in 2019 at 235 tonnes, which also experienced the largest increase of 8.6%.

From 2018 to 2021, Croatia, Montenegro, and Slovenia were the leading destinations for Bosnia and Herzegovina's exports of prepared or preserved groundnuts in volume terms. Croatia accounted for 59.1% of exports, Montenegro for 20.9%, and Slovenia for 8.5%, collectively representing 88.5% of total export flows.

Exports in value, K $ US

After two years of growth, Bosnia and Herzegovina's export value of prepared or preserved groundnuts declined. In 2021, exports reached 588 thousand US dollars, showing a drop of 1.5% year-on-year. The highest value was recorded in 2020 at 597 thousand US dollars, which also saw the largest increase of 2.8%.

Between 2018 and 2021, Croatia, Montenegro, and Slovenia emerged as the primary markets for Bosnia and Herzegovina's exports of prepared or preserved groundnuts in value terms. Croatia contributed 57.9% of export value, Montenegro 19.1%, and Slovenia 11.9%, together accounting for 88.8% of total export flows.

Imports prepared or preserved groundnuts to Bosnia and Herzegovina

Imports in kind, t

Following two years of decline, Bosnia and Herzegovina's imports of prepared or preserved groundnuts increased. In 2021, the country imported 1 082 tonnes, reflecting a modest rise of 5.4% compared to 2020. Over the period from 2018 to 2021, imports decreased by 9.8%, equivalent to an annualized decline of 3.4%. The lowest import volume was recorded in 2020 at 1 026 tonnes, while the largest decline occurred in 2019, with a drop of 11.0%.

From 2018 to 2021, three key markets—Argentina, Serbia, and China—collectively accounted for 80.4% of Bosnia and Herzegovina's total imports of prepared or preserved groundnuts in volume terms.

Imports in value, K $ US

Bosnia and Herzegovina's import value of prepared or preserved groundnuts rose for the second year in a row. In 2021, imports totaled 3 594 thousand US dollars, corresponding to a significant increase of 22.1% compared to 2020. Between 2018 and 2021, imports grew by 4%, equating to an annualized rate of 1.3%. The lowest value was recorded in 2019 at 2 793 thousand US dollars, which also experienced the largest decline of 19.2%.

Throughout 2018 to 2021, Argentina, Serbia, and Bulgaria played the leading roles in Bosnia and Herzegovina's imports of prepared or preserved groundnuts in value terms. Argentina accounted for 43.9% of import value, Serbia for 29.8%, and Bulgaria for 5.3%, jointly representing 79.0% of total import flows.
